Cleveland “Cleve” Glover Meredith Jr. is a white man from Hiawassee, Georgia, United States. He is married and he has two sons.

Meredith is a Donald Trump supporter. Here are 13 more things about the Hiawassee resident:

  1. He grew up in Atlanta, Georgia. His father owns a company that makes utility poles while his mother is a homemaker-turned-interior decorator. His parents described him as “a great person who had fallen from grace into far-right-extremist territory.” He had two sisters. One of them died of brain cancer. (a)
  2. In 1986, he graduated from The Lovett School in Atlanta. He led the school to cross-country championships twice. (a)
  3. From 1987 to 1990, he attended the University of the South in Sewanee, Tennessee, USA where he earned his bachelor’s degree in economics. During a fight with a group of visiting football players from Lambuth College in Tennessee in 1989, which he started, he and his girlfriend made racist and derogatory comments. (b) (c)
  4. He was one of the owners of Car-Nutz Car Wash, a car wash in Acworth, Cobb County, Georgia. In June 2018, he put up a billboard that reads “#QANON” with the Car-Nurtz Car Wash name in the bottom left corner. Since 2019, he has not been associated with the company, which has been renamed.   5. After he and his wife separated in 2019, he moved from Cobb County to Hiawassee.  (c) 
  6. In March 2019, he showed up at an event in Lovett in his unmistakable Saab to protest against Jon Meacham, a Pulitzer Prize-winning historian who was there to speak about current affairs. (a)
  7. In 2020, he moved from Hiawassee to North Carolina, USA. He showed up with an IWI Tavor X95 rifle to hold a counterprotest at the Hiawassee Town Square in Hiawassee where around 50 Black Lives Matter protesters were gathered from 4:00 p.m. to 6:00 p.m. on June 5, 2020. He believed the Black Lives Matter movement is “basically a political stunt done by the higher ups, just paying people to screw everything up” and disagreed with “the violence surrounding” the movement. He described himself as “a fifth-generation Atlantan” who supports “America, freedom and Donald Trump.” (c) (e)
  8. In November 2020, he attended a protest outside of  83rd Georgia governor Brian Kemp in Georgia, he told the Federal Bureau of Investigation agents on January 7, 2021.  (f)
  9. On December 19, 2020, he wrote on Facebook, “GOAT POTUS calls for PROTEST in D.C. on January 6, 2021…he’ll be giving us PATRIOTS our licenses.” (a)
  10. He celebrated 2021 New Year with his sons on a skiing trip to Crested Butte, Colorado, USA. (a)
  11. From Colorado, he arrived in Washington, D.C. on January 6, 2021. However, he was too late for the Stop the Steal rally at the Ellipse where Trump’s supporters gathered. (f)
  12. On January 7, 2021, FBI agents made contact with him in his hotel room at the Holiday Inn in Washington, D.C. He agreed to speak with the FBI agents without a lawyer present and allowed them to search his hotel room, his Ford truck, a Spartan trailer that can attach to the truck, and his mobile telephone. A Glock 19, nine millimeter pistol, a Tavor X95 assault rifle and approximately hundreds of rounds of ammunition were found in the trailer. Earlier that day, he sent a text message to a certain individual saying, “Thinking about heading over to Pelosi C***’s speech and putting a bullet in her noggin on Live TV.” He added a purple devil emoji. He was accused of possession of an unregistered firearm and unlawful possession of ammunition and was charged with making interstate threats to 52nd U.S. house of representatives speaker Nancy Pelosi.   13. On January 8, 2021, the Metropolitan Police Department of the District of Columbia found that he does not possess a registration for any firearm in Washington, D.C. (f)
